Fence Picket, Post & Rail Calculator
Posts, rails and pickets for a wood fence run — solid privacy or spaced picket, either way.
Set posts a third of their height into the ground and below frost depth. For privacy fences butted tight, expect ~5 mm shrinkage gaps to open as the pickets dry — that's normal.

The calculation implements posts = ⌈L ÷ spacing⌉ + 1; pickets = L ÷ (width + gap) × 1.05 (AWPA ground-contact lumber guidance; fence trade practice).
